RBI Credit Control from www.slideshare.net New Credit Control Techniques of RBI in 2023 Introduction The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) is the central banking institution of India and controls the monetary policy of the Indian currency. The RBI uses a variety of instruments to control credit in the economy. Some of these instruments are discussed in this article. Cash Reserve Ratio (CRR) The Cash Reserve Ratio (CRR) is the percentage of total deposits that banks must keep with the RBI. The CRR is used by the RBI to control the amount of credit that banks can give. By increasing the CRR, the RBI can make it more difficult for banks to lend, thus reducing the amount of money in the economy. The current CRR is 4%. Statutory Liquidity Ratio (SLR) The Statutory Liquidity Ratio (SLR) is the percentage of total deposits that banks are required to maintain in liquid form. your Credit Control issues with Credit Hound from itassolutions.co.uk What is Credit Control? Credit control is the process of managing a company's credit risk. It's the practice of analyzing and managing the creditworthiness of customers to ensure that credit is extended responsibly and profitability. This includes setting credit limits, monitoring customer payments, and collecting outstanding amounts. Credit control is an important tool for businesses to ensure that they do not overextend themselves financially, as it helps to protect their profit margins.
